Bespoke vs. Modular: Why the Price Varies
Modular systems rely on standard-sized carcasses. If your wall is 245cm wide and the units are 60cm, you’ll end up with 5cm of “filler” panels that serve no purpose. Bespoke systems are different. We manufacture every unit to millimetre-perfect dimensions in our Slough workshop. This eliminates the need for unsightly gaps and ensures you’re paying for actual storage volume rather than decorative plywood. Alcove and Chimney Breast Solutions
Victorian and Edwardian homes in Richmond and Chiswick often feature deep alcoves flanking a central chimney breast. These spaces are rarely square. They require specialised scribing, which is a process where our craftsmen hand-finish the panels to follow the exact, often wonky, line of your walls. Installing a pair of wardrobes simultaneously is often more cost-efficient than tackling them one by one. It streamlines the design and installation process whilst ensuring a symmetrical, balanced look for your bedroom. Loft Conversions and Eaves Storage
Attic spaces present the most significant technical challenge due to coombed ceilings and sloped walls. A fitted wardrobes loft solution is a high-value investment because it turns otherwise unusable eaves into premium storage. These projects carry an “awkward space” premium because every internal shelf and external door must be cut at precise angles to match the roofline. However, the result is a room that feels twice as large and significantly more organised.
